' Zafarullah detenu has been produced by the bailiff. According to the report of the bailiff he was found detained in Police Station, Mananwala. He disclosed at the time of recovery that his shoulder has been dislocated by hanging on a rope. The police did not show his arrest or involvement in any criminal case. The Duty Officer Muhammad Tariq, Head Constable on inquiry stated that he does not know anything about the detenu or his involvement. HoWeyer, one Sikandar Hayat, A.S.-I. Stated that Rana Manzoor Ahmad, Sub-Inspector arrested the detenu who was seen by the bailiff in uniform in the Police Station and he slipped away from the main gate in his presence. Bailiff requested to the Duty Officer and other police officials to call Manzoor Ahmad, Sub-Inspector to inquire about the involvement of the detenu or other relevant facts but he did not appear. Let the statement of detenu be recorded.
' Statement of detenu has been recorded on a separate sheet. Manzoor Ahmad, S.-I. States that he took into custody Zafarullah on 22-6-2000 at about 10/11-00 a.m. In case F.I.R. No, 178 of 2000 ' registered at Police Station, Mananwala under section 457/380, P.P.C. And locked him in the Police Station. He did not produce him before the Court to get the remand. The formal arrest was also not recorded in the daily diary or the other relevant record he states that he committed a mistake, for which he may be forgiven.
2. The perusal of F.I.R. No,178 of 2000 shows that the detenu is not nominated accused. However, on a supplementary statement, dated 5-6-2000 complainant implicated the detenu. There are serious doubts about the veracity of the supplementary statement, dated 5-6-2000. The fact remains that detenu was in custody of Manzoor Ahmad, S.-I./I.O. Who was not produced before a competent Court for seeking remand, his detention from 22-6-2000 till recovery by the bailiff on 24-6-2000 and torture by the police are unlawful. A case shall be registered against the Sub- Inspector for causing torture and keeping Zafarullah under wrongful detention from 22-6-2000 to 24-6-2000. However, the registration of this case will not affect the merits of the case registered vide F.I.R. No,178 of 2000. After registration of the case the investigation shall be transferred to a senior police officer not below the rank of Deputy Superintendent of Police and final result of the investigation shall be communicated to this Court through the Deputy Registrar (Judicial) within two months.
3. Learned counsel for the petitioner has also requested for granting protective bail to the detenu in order to approach the Sessions Court for pre-arrest bail. Since the detenu is not nominated in the F.I.R. And his implication through supplementary statement as stated above is open to serious doubts, he is admitted to seven days' protective bail subject to his furnishing bail bonds in the sum of Rs,50,000 with one surety in the like amount to the satisfaction of the trial Court/Duty Magistrate to enable him to make the application to the Sessions Court for appropriate relief of bail. As far as the present habeas petition is concerned, the same is allowed in the terms indicated above. The detenu shall appear before the S.H.O., Police Station Mananwala for recording his statement whereupon the case shall be registered as observed above. Copy Dasti.
